Industry challenges

Four problems D2C brands hit. None of them fix themselves.

D2C paid acquisition has its own physics — ROAS ceilings, creative fatigue, attribution noise, subscription churn. Here's how we approach the four that surface on nearly every audit.

01 · ROAS

ROAS decay at scale.

Every D2C account hits a ceiling where adding spend stops adding revenue. The standard agency answer is “saturation.” The real answer is usually broken attribution, fatigued creative, or an unmeasured retargeting layer — not the market.

How we approach:Rebuild measurement first, then creative pipeline, then push spend. Spend is the last lever — everything below it has to be tuned before the ceiling lifts.
02 · Creative

Creative fatigue at the pace of TikTok.

Winning ads stop working in 2–3 weeks. Brands without a creative engine lose ground every cycle — CPMs climb, frequency caps, CVR drops. Most accounts ship 1–2 new variants per week. That isn't a pipeline; that's a leak.

How we approach: 10+ variants per week through UGC + creator + studio pipelines, hit-rate scored, winners amplified, losers rotated. Creative becomes the input, not the bottleneck.
03 · Cohort

First-purchase ROAS hides retention.

Subscription brands are multi-purchase businesses; first-purchase ROAS is a single-purchase metric. Brands optimizing for the wrong number scale the wrong customers — cheap-to-acquire, high-churn cohorts that look profitable for a quarter and bleed for a year.

How we approach: Cohort LTV reporting at month-3 and month-6 checkpoints. Subscription-aware bid modelling. The campaigns we cut are the ones the dashboard rewards; the ones we scale are the ones leadership rewards.
04 · Attribution

Platform numbers don't match the P&L.

Meta says ROAS 3.5×, the CRM says 2.1×. Most accounts trust the platform because it's the only number they have. After iOS 14 and ITP, that trust is increasingly statistical fiction — modeled conversions, attribution-window stretching, and post-event guessing fill the gap.

How we approach: Server-side conversions + offline import + CRM stitching. The platform learns from cleaner signal, leadership trusts the dashboard, and blended CAC numbers stop diverging from the bank account.

Depends on AOV and repeat rate. High-AOV one-purchase brands (think furniture, premium electronics) need CAC payback within the first purchase — usually 0.8–1.2× first-order revenue. Subscription or repeat-heavy brands can afford 3–6 month payback because LTV compounds. We model your specific cohort LTV before deciding what a healthy CAC even looks like — first-purchase ROAS lies on subscription brands.

Stock Shopify CAPI apps pass 2–3 of the 8 match-quality parameters Meta needs — we rebuild it server-side via sGTM or Stape so EMQ climbs from 5/10 to 9+/10. For checkout subdomain tracking (most Shopify stores have checkout on shop.app or a Shopify-hosted subdomain), we mirror cookies across so the conversion attributes back to the click that brought them.

Yes — very different. Subscription brands need LTV-adjusted ROAS plugged into Meta (the algorithm bids on first-purchase by default, which understates Meta’s real contribution by 2–5×). One-time brands need cohort-specific creative for first-time vs repeat buyers. We model both before deciding the channel strategy.

Limited inventory means we can’t just “turn the dial.” We optimize for sell-through velocity per SKU instead of blanket ROAS — pause campaigns on out-of-stock SKUs same-day, push budget toward in-stock high-margin items. Catalog feeds get hygiene checks weekly. This is one of the highest-leverage moves for fashion / accessories / F&B with seasonal inventory.

Most brands underestimate the channel-cannibalization effect. We model marketplace orders (Amazon, Tokopedia, Shopee) as part of the attribution layer so paid spend that drives marketplace conversion still gets credited. The strategic question we surface: which products belong on DTC vs marketplace, and what does pricing look like across both?

Single engagement is more efficient if the brands share an audience or back-office — we discount additional accounts (2nd–5th brand at −20%, 6+ at −30%). Separate engagements make sense if the brands have radically different ICPs and would otherwise dilute the strategist’s attention. Most portfolio holding-cos run them under one umbrella with brand-specific channel pods.

Sell thousands of products across multiple brands and you hit one wall fast: you can't advertise everything to everyone. This retailer was competing in a market where shelf space is infinite but attention isn't. So we built a Google Ads system around what shoppers were actually searching for, using brand level segmentation matched to how people buy and tuned for conversion, not traffic. Every dollar came back more than 19× in tracked revenue, with monthly conversions growing to over 3,400, more than 5× since launch. Paid search went from a line item cost to the store's most reliable revenue engine.
